Career path

Career Role (Privacy Law) Description
Privacy Officer (Data Protection Officer) Develops and implements privacy policies and procedures; ensures compliance with UK data protection laws (GDPR, UK GDPR). High demand.
Data Protection Consultant Advises businesses on data protection best practices; conducts audits and risk assessments; provides training on privacy law. Strong growth trajectory.
Legal Counsel (Privacy) Provides legal advice on data privacy issues; drafts contracts and policies; manages data breach responses. Competitive salary.
Compliance Manager (Data Privacy) Monitors compliance with privacy regulations; conducts internal investigations; manages relationships with regulatory bodies. Excellent job prospects.
